I have installed a 320 gig hard drive on my xbox, I would like to upgrade to a 500 gb. Now my question is do i follow the same instructions as to formatting the 500 gb. Instructions i used were: http://www.smdepot.net/forum/index.php?topic=176.0

when you use xboxhdm to create your 500 gig harddrive it will ask you do you want to format F and partition it. choose yes.
also when you install it back into your xbox and go to "run linux" from one of the game saves (Krazies NDure )
when you pop in the game again and goto "runlinux" after it's modded it'll have an "extras" option, choose that and you can format F there as well.
this will work if you choose NKPATCHER 06
this makes it all 1 large F partition. and no G is needed.

any HDD bigger then 400G (or really 200G) should set .67 for F: and G:  if you set ALL on F: you can/will get corrupted data after placeing to much data on the Drive.

I only point this out as i have expertised this myself

+ with a 500g i beleave you need to change the clusters with a program Witch for the life of me i can't remeber.

I just uploaded xbpartitioner to my E drive and formatted both 6 and 7 (F and G) with one of the preset options and it split my 750 into 370/370 or something to that effect. Whatever it works out to. But it did fix any issues and I've since filled it and I haven't run into any problems since. F and G don't necessarily need to be formatted before you use it since it's going to format them anyway
